The Royal Agricultural Society of NSW (RAS) is a not for profit organisation that has been helping to shape agriculture in Australia since 1822. Boasting a membership base of 12,000 people, the RAS is responsible for conducting the iconic Sydney Royal Easter Show and the Sydney Royal Wine, Dairy and Fine Food Shows as well as other events and activities throughout the year. The RAS manages Sydney Showground located at Sydney Olympic Park and the Australasian Animal Registry (AAR).
